Hello everyone,

I'm sure some eyes will roll and people might tear me a new one for this but here goes lol

I have a 2018 ram rebel 5.7

I'm just now learning about mods and I need some help when it comes to exhaust systems. Can someone please dumb it down a bit for me? I would like to switch things up in order to hear the roar of the v8.

I'm thinking ideally I would do a cat back system but I've also read that a cost friendly option could be as simple as changing out the muffler. I know that I can hear the sounds on youtube but i'm wondering what to look for when I shop for a muffler? What makes one better then others other then the way it sounds?

What size would I be looking for? 3 inch in and 2.5inch out? Where can I find the info for my truck?

Thank you to anyone who has the patience to read through this and wants to offer some help.

The stock exhaust is 3" in and 2.25" out if you have the factory dual pipes,the out is basically an oddball 2.25"
